Html 我的中小型移动电话应答器不工作?我需要使用什么属性
我对中小型移动设备的响应不起作用?我需要使用什么属性。我使用的是firefox。如果我收缩浏览器进行测试,则徽标没有针对移动设备进行调整。对于测试,我已使用背景黄色。黄色即将出现,但移动设备的图像没有收缩。我使用了宽度:250px;对于小型移动设备,您可以测试链接。谁能指导我下一步做什么Html 我的中小型移动电话应答器不工作?我需要使用什么属性,html,css,Html,Css,我对中小型移动设备的响应不起作用?我需要使用什么属性。我使用的是firefox。如果我收缩浏览器进行测试,则徽标没有针对移动设备进行调整。对于测试,我已使用背景黄色。黄色即将出现,但移动设备的图像没有收缩。我使用了宽度:250px;对于小型移动设备,您可以测试链接。谁能指导我下一步做什么 my html code: <div id="wrapper"> <div id="logo"><img src="image/logo.png" border="0" widt
my html code:
<div id="wrapper">
<div id="logo"><img src="image/logo.png" border="0" width="357" height="107"/></div><!--endoflogo-->
<div id="logo1"><a href="#">join as tutor or Institutue</a></div><!--endoflogo1-->
<div id="menu">
<div class="common"><a href="#">About us</a></div>
<div class="common"><a href="#">Department</a></div>
<div class="common"><a href="#">Facilities</a></div>
<div class="common"><a href="#">library</a></div>
<div class="common"><a href="#">Event</a></div>
</div><!--endofmenu-->
</div><!--endofwrapper-->
default.css
@charset "utf-8";
body
{
margin:auto;
background-color:#CCCCCC;
background-repeat:repeat;
}
#wrapper
{
width:1000px;
height:auto;
margin:auto;
}
#logo
{
width:500px;
height:100px;
float:left;
}
#logo1
{
width:400px;
height:80px;
float:left;
padding-left:50px;
padding-right:50px;
background-color:#FF00FF;
}
#menu
{
width:1000px;
height:45px;
float:left;
}
.common
{
width:200px;
height:42px;
padding-top:8px;
float:left;
background-color:#FFFFFF;
background-repeat:no-repeat;
text-align:center;
}
mobile.css
@media only screen and (max-width:530px)
{
#wrapper
{
width:260px;
background-repeat:repeat;
}
#logo
{
width:260px;
text-align:center;
background-color:#FFFF00;
}
#logo1
{
width:160px;
padding-left:50px;
padding-right:50px;
}
#menu
{
width:260px;
height:auto;
}
}
我的html代码:
default.css
@字符集“utf-8”;
身体
{
保证金:自动;
背景色:#中交;
背景重复:重复;
}
#包装纸
{
宽度:1000px;
高度:自动;
保证金:自动;
}
#标志
{
宽度:500px;
高度:100px;
浮动:左;
}
#标识1
{
宽度:400px;
高度:80px;
浮动:左;
左侧填充:50px;
右边填充:50px;
背景色:#FF00FF;
}
#菜单
{
宽度:1000px;
高度:45px;
浮动:左;
}
常见的
{
宽度:200px;
高度:42px;
填充顶部:8px;
浮动:左;
背景色:#FFFFFF;
背景重复:无重复;
文本对齐:居中;
}
mobile.css
@仅介质屏幕和(最大宽度:530像素)
{
#包装纸
{
宽度:260px;
背景重复:重复;
}
#标志
{
宽度:260px;
文本对齐:居中;
背景色:#FFFF00;
}
#标识1
{
宽度:160px;
左侧填充:50px;
右边填充:50px;
}
#菜单
{
宽度:260px;
高度:自动;
}
}
在响应性设计中使用px
,这确实不太好
只需将此属性添加到css中
img {
width: 100% !important;
}
我的建议是在任何地方使用
%
和em
避免px
图像未正确收缩的原因是,只选择了#logo,只设置了图像容器的宽度,而不是图像本身的宽度
如果添加此css:
#logo img { width:260px; }
进入你的反应规则,那么你应该是好去
此外,如果您想更改平板电脑设备的图像,我建议您使用以下方式:
@media only screen
and (min-device-width : 768px)
and (max-device-width : 1024px) {
/* tablet CSS here */
}
可以找到有关媒体查询的其他信息。将其添加到移动css中
#logo img{
max-width:100%;
}
演示您的链接似乎已断开。是的,它正在工作。您检查相同的链接。如果我想为大型移动设备和平板电脑制作我需要编写的媒体查询,请执行相同的操作。我正在考虑如何制作菜单。如果我单击一个图像。如切换效果我更新了我的答案,以包括一个可接受的平板电脑设备的媒体查询。是的,我得到了这个问题。我的最后一个问题是如何制作菜单。当我单击一个图像时,它具有切换效果。或者通常我如何制作菜单。我对此没有任何想法。你能写一个小的吗你能帮我用手机的css菜单吗。